Название: C++ Crash Course: A Fast-Paced Introduction Автор: Josh Lospinoso Издательство: No Starch Press Год: 2019 Формат: PDF Страниц: 794 Размер: 10,09 МБ Язык: English
A fast-paced, thorough introduction to modern C++ written for experienced programmers. After reading C++ Crash Course, you'll be proficient in the core language concepts, the C++ Standard Library, and the Boost Libraries. C++ is one of the most widely used languages for real-world software. In the hands of a knowledgeable programmer, C++ can produce small, efficient, and readable code that any programmer would be proud of.
Designed for intermediate to advanced programmers, C++ Crash Course cuts through the weeds to get you straight to the core of C++17, the most modern revision of the ISO standard. Part 1 covers the core of the C++ language, where you'll learn about everything from types and functions, to the object life cycle and expressions. Part 2 introduces you to the C++ Standard Library and Boost Libraries, where you'll learn about all of the high-quality, fully-featured facilities available to you. You'll cover special utility classes, data structures, and algorithms, and learn how to manipulate file systems and build high-performance programs that communicate over networks.
You'll learn all the major features of modern C++, including: * Fundamental types, reference types, and user-defined types * The object lifecycle including storage duration, memory management, exceptions, call stacks, and the RAII paradigm * Compile-time polymorphism with templates and run-time polymorphism with virtual classes * Advanced expressions, statements, and functions * Smart pointers, data structures, dates and times, numerics, and probability/statistics facilities * Containers, iterators, strings, and algorithms * Streams and files, concurrency, networking, and application development
With well over 500 code samples and nearly 100 exercises, C++ Crash Course is sure to help you build a strong C++ foundation.
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
С этой публикацией часто скачивают:
Python Crash Course, 2nd Edition (2019) Название: Python Crash Course, 2nd Edition Автор: Eric Matthes Издательство: No Starch Press Год: 2019 Страниц: 544 Язык: английский Формат:...
A Tour of C++ (C++ In-Depth Series) Название: A Tour of C++ (C++ In-Depth Series) Автор: Bjarne Stroustrup Издательство: Addison-Wesley Professional Год: 2013 Формат: PDF Страниц: 192...
The Quick Python Book, 3rd Edition Название: The Quick Python Book, 3rd Edition Автор: Naomi Ceder Год: 2018 Страниц: 472 Формат: PDF Размер: 10 Mb Язык: English This third revision...
Learning Swift Programming Название: Learning Swift Programming Автор: Jacob Schatz Издательство: Addison-Wesley Professional Год: 2015 Страниц: 300 Формат: True PDF Размер: 10...
C++ Primer, 5th Edition Автор: Stanley B. Lippman, Jos?e Lajoie, Barbara E. Moo Название: C++ Primer, 5th Edition Издательство: Addison-Wesley Professional Год: 2012 ISBN:...
Java in a Nutshell, 6th Edition Название: Java in a Nutshell, 6th Edition Автор: Benjamin J Evans, David Flanagan Издательство: O'Reilly Media Год: 2014 Формат: PDF, EPUB Размер: 37...
Core Java for the Impatient Название: Core Java for the Impatient Автор: Cay S. Horstmann Издательство: Addison-Wesley Professional Год: 2015 Формат: PDF, EPUB Страниц:1556...
Информация
Посетители, находящиеся в группе Гости, не могут оставлять комментарии к данной публикации.